Description

Situated in a spectacular and secluded waterfront location on the Mizen Peninsula, this beautifully crafted detached residence enjoys breathtaking views over Dunmanus Bay towards the Sheep's Head Peninsula. Built in 2005, the property is tucked into the headland and completely hidden from view, accessed via a private driveway off a quiet minor public road. Set on approximately 30 acres of land that runs directly to the water's edge, it offers exceptional privacy, expansive space, and a profound sense of escape. Measuring approximately 235 sq. m (2,530 sq. ft), this exceptionally well-built three-bedroom residence combines generous proportions with energy-efficient design. With a B2 energy rating, it benefits from a geo-thermal heat pump and underfloor heating throughout the ground floor, ensuring year-round comfort and efficiency. Crafted with care and attention to detail, the house showcases the use of natural, locally sourced materials throughout. A Bangor Blue slate roof, solid timber ceilings, and feature stonework—including a striking entrance hall wall and an impressive fireplace surround—create a warm, tactile interior. The exterior echoes this palette with a blend of painted render and the same natural stone, tying the home beautifully to its rugged surroundings. A sunken stone terrace enhances the outdoor living space—offering a sheltered and atmospheric spot to take in the wild coastal beauty. The accommodation flows seamlessly, with thoughtful orientation to maximise natural light and make the most of the ever-changing views. There are three main reception rooms, offering flexibility for family living and entertaining. At the heart of the home is a substantial, handcrafted bespoke kitchen with timber worktops, integrated appliances, and traditional detailing. This inviting space shares a large open hearth with the adjoining sitting room, creating a central focus and sense of warmth. Vaulted, tongue and groove timber ceilings in the main living and dining areas add drama and light, while a cleverly designed, wind-sheltered outdoor link between the dining and living rooms offers a practical and scenic extension of the indoor space. The sleeping accommodation includes a spacious ground-floor master bedroom with en suite bathroom, a guest bedroom on the lower ground floor with garden access, and a third bedroom at first floor level. A notable feature of the holding are the remnants of pre-Famine dwellings located on the land—a quiet testament to the deep heritage of this remote corner of West Cork. Framed by the wild beauty of the peninsula, these stone remains offer a sense of continuity and connection to place. While not currently in use, they are an evocative part of the property's story. The land itself of mixed agricultural quality, represents a substantial and increasingly rare holding by local standard; offering the chance to own a piece of dramatic waterfront landscape, with its untamed scenery, sweeping views, and unrivalled seclusion. The property lies approximately 5km from the village of Goleen, a traditional West Cork village known for its friendly atmosphere, local pubs, and close proximity to Crookhaven and Barleycove Beach. Bantry, a vibrant market town just 30 minutes' drive away, is a renowned cultural hub. It hosts the internationally acclaimed West Cork Chamber Music Festival and the Bantry Literary Festival, attracting artists, musicians, and writers from around the world and enriching the town's strong artistic and creative reputation. ACCOMMODATION Entrance Hall: Tiled flooring with a striking feature wall of locally sourced natural stone. Master Bedroom (1): Dual aspect with sweeping water views, generous ceiling height, and a full wall of built-in wardrobes. En Suite Bathroom: Timber-panelled bath with tiled surround, wash basin with tiled splashback, and WC. Shower Room: Tiled floor with large, tiled shower enclosure, WC, and wash hand basin. Living Room: A bright, expansive space with vaulted, timber-beamed ceilings, triple aspect windows, and direct access to the sun deck. Features a raised open hearth with natural stone surround. Dining Room: Light-filled room with vaulted ceilings, triple access to the sheltered courtyard, and superb views over the bay. Sitting Room: Inviting space with built-in shelving, open hearth fireplace with kitchen and dual aspect windows. Kitchen: Handcrafted by a local artisan cabinetmaker, featuring extensive wall and floor units, timber countertops, integrated appliances, a food prep sink, and a stainless steel double sink with drainer. Utility / Boot Room: Practical space with built-in storage, plumbed for washer and dryer, and home to the geothermal heat pump and water tank. Porch: Useful transitional space connecting the house to the outdoors. Stairs down to: Bedroom 2: A generously sized room with independent access to the garden—ideal for guests or additional privacy. Stairs up to: Bedroom 3: Cosy and bright with timber flooring, built-in wardrobe, and a picture window capturing uninterrupted waterfront views. Title: Freehold BER: BER: B2 BER No: 118217157 EPI: 100.76 kWh/m²/yr Services: Well water Geo-thermal heat Pump Septic tank
